Oil prices are stable at the opening bell, consolidating gains made last week after the U.S. Federal Reserve Chair opened the door to a potential interest rate cut in September. Brent crude is trading at $67.91 a barrel (+0.27%) after climbing almost 3% last week, while West Texas Intermediate (WTI) is at $63.84 a barrel (+0.28%).
